Makes you wonder. If clubs are having this much of a problem (you can add Barrow who have had this problem 2 years running, & Dewsbury). With 3 months. What the squads of the middle 8's teams are going to be like. Given that at most they have a month, and if you get them in August about a week etc.
Apparently part of the problem is not just to do with criminal records. But also if you have a spent conviction they require relevant paperwork, and this is what's causing problems.

Canada's visa laws have not changed. Remember if you will that when the Wolfpack made their first ever trip from England to Canada in May 2017, two players were refused boarding on that first flight and missed the first ever home game. One was Fui Fui, not sure of the other one. Both arrived for the second game later in May.
At least two League 1 teams had visa issues in 2017, I'm pretty sure Barrow was one.

Ding ding ding.
Due to injuries, Barrow Raiders brought amateur Ben Garner for their trip to the Wolfpack last month. He joined the team on the Tuesday and was on the flight on the Thursday. Visas can be obtained with no trouble if the requirements are met.
Wolfpack provide the services of an immigration consultant so there really are no excuses.
